Bravo-six is the Captain’s callsign. ‘going dark’ means that the operator is initiating radio silence. An iconic line said by Captain John Price, from the game Call Of Duty: Modern Warfare. WebUnder some conventions, 6 is designated the commander or leader, 5 the second-in-command or executive officer, 7 the chief NCO. Also, companies often have the letter …
